I’m very impressed with Luna Grill. My friend suggested meeting for lunch here since it’s halfway between my place at the west end of the 56 and hers at the east end. There aren’t a lot of choices midway and Luna Grill’s great reviews sealed the deal for us. When we arrived at 11:30 on New Year’s Eve, there was no one else in the restaurant but the lunch crowd arrived shortly after. It was a good thing we arrived early because there’s a lot of choices on the menu and it took us several minutes to make a decision. I ended up trying the chicken wrap, which comes on pita bread with lettuce, tomato and onion(but no onion for me!). The wrap was overflowing with delicious chunks of chicken that were seasoned wonderfully. Seriously, it was one of the better chicken pitas that I’ve tasted and I highly recommend it. Even the fries were a step up, which I attribute to the dusting of seasoned salt. They also taste great dipped in the tzatziki sauce. It seemed like the food took awhile to arrive at our table though. It’s definitely not fast food and I wouldn’t recommend coming here if you’re in a hurry. But my friend and I had plenty of time so it wasn’t a big deal to us.

I continue to have good luck with Luna Grills’ around town, which continues to encourage me to visit them. This time, I came in for lunch and ordered the single grilled chicken wrap and a bowl of their hearty lentil soup. As you usual, you order at the counter, take a number to your table, and they bring over your food. The young lady who served me was great and had a great sense of humor. which made my lunch meal all the better. The lentil soup, was first for me trying at Luna, and I was pleasantly surprise on how well it was prepared. The lentils were abundant, well cooked to a tender touch, and tasted great. The soup base was well seasoned and arrived piping hot. The soup also came with a few vegetables and they were good. I would easily order this again for the $ 4 price. The grilled chicken wrap was very good as well. It came with plenty of tender chopped chicken that perhaps could of been seasoned a little more, but the fresh flavor of the other ingredients, specifically the yogurt sauce, quickly masked that. The pita bread was warm, fluffy, and moist and the perfect vessel for the wrap. You can also get the wrap in a multigrain flat bread. This made for the perfect simple lunch. Like I said, service was very good and the food hit the spot in more ways then one.
